Natural-cycle IVF (Portuguese: FIV em ciclo natural) is an advanced assisted-reproduction technique regulated in Portugal by the CNPMA under Lei n.º 32/2006. This page explains, for patients in Lajes do Pico (Açores district, Açores), when Natural-cycle IVF is appropriate, the reference price in Portugal, and where licensed centres operate. Retrieval of the single naturally-selected oocyte, no stimulation.
When Natural-cycle IVF is indicated
Young women with poor stimulation response or who decline hormonal stimulation.
The clinical decision should follow a full work-up of the couple — history, semen analysis, ovarian reserve (AMH and antral follicle count) and review of prior cycles when applicable. In Lajes do Pico, this work-up can usually be done locally with subsequent referral to a CNPMA-authorised PMA centre. The request should include a written clinical justification: CNPMA requires technique-specific informed consent and SNS or insurance funding depends on this rationale.
Important clinical caveat: High per-cycle cancellation rate (up to 40%) due to premature ovulation; requires tight LH monitoring. — use this to ask the clinic whether the indication is robust or whether the technique is being proposed routinely without evidence for your specific case.

Cost of Natural-cycle IVF (private and SNS)
In Portugal, Natural-cycle IVF typically costs between €1,800 and €3,500 privately.
At Portugal's SNS, CNPMA-authorised techniques are free for eligible patients — typically up to age 40, with clinical indication and no shared child with the same partner (technique-specific rules apply). Waiting lists at the most demanded public centres can reach 12–24 months. Medication is partially reimbursed via SNS prescription.
Privately, request a detailed written quote covering: medical fees, laboratory, medication, annual cryopreservation (if applicable), and cancellation/refund policy. Safety, ethics and sources
Natural-cycle IVF is subject to the same legal and ethical guarantees as all PMA techniques in Portugal: written informed consent before each act, second opinion, access to the medical record, and complaint rights with the Health Regulator (ERS). Gamete and embryo cryopreservation is capped at 3 renewable years and any gamete donation is anonymous by default (offspring may access non-identifying data at age 18).
